ARCHIVE-FOOTAGE TREASURE FLOATING IN THE AEGEAN SEA

By Pamela Biénzobas

The 19th Thessaloniki Documentary Festival (March 3-12), in northern Greece, made a case for the rich and wonderfully diverse possibilities that archive footage has to offer, showcasing some true gems within its different programs, including a tribute to Italian artists Angela Ricci Lucchi and Yervant Gianikian.

THESSALONIKI FESTIVAL 2012: DEAD EUROPE BY TONY KRAWITZ

By Mónica Delgado

Dead Europe is a hard novel by the Greek Australian Christos Tsiolkas, adapted by Tony Krawitz in a suggestive manner. The filmmaker takes the second part from the book and changes the places for ones more suitable in order to portray a powerful cartography, an archetype of the Europe that he sees dying.
